FAR 52.212-4 Contract Terms and Conditions-Commercial Items (Oct 2008), FAR 52.217-8 Option to Extend Services (Nov 1999), FAR 52.217-9 Option to Extend the Term of the Contract (Mar 2000), FAR 52.219-26 Small Disadvantaged Business Participation Program-Incentive Subcontracting (Oct 2000), FAR 52.222-3 Convict Labor (June 2003), 52.222-19 Child Labor-Cooperation With Authorities and Remedies (Aug 2009), FAR 52.222-21 -- Prohibition of Segregated Facilities (FEB 1999), FAR 52.222-26 Equal Opportunity (Mar 2007), DFARS 252.204-7004 Central Contractor Registration (52.204-7) Alternate A (Sep 2007), DFARS 252.225-7000 Buy American Act--Balance Of Payments Program Certificate (Jun 2005), DFARS 252.225-7001 Buy American Act and Balance of Payments Program (Jun 2005), DFARS 252.225-7002 Qualifying Country Sources as Subcontractors (APR 2003), DFARS 252.246-7000 Materials Inspection and Receiving Report (MAR 2008), DFARS 252.232-7003 Electronic Submission of Payment Request and Receiving Reports (Mar 2008), AFFARS 5352.201-9101 Ombudsman (Aug 2005) (a) An ombudsman has been appointed to hear and facilitate the resolution of concerns from offerors, potential offerors, and others for this acquisition. When requested, the ombudsman will maintain strict Confidentiality as to the source of the concern. The existence of the ombudsman does not affect the authority of the program manager, contracting officer, or source selection official. Further, the ombudsman does not participate in the evaluation of proposals, the source selection process, or the adjudication of protests or formal contract disputes. The ombudsman may refer the party to another official who can resolve the concern. (b) Before consulting with an ombudsman, interested parties must first address their concerns, issues, disagreements, and/or recommendations to the contracting officer for resolution. Consulting an ombudsman does not alter or postpone the timelines for any other processes (e.g., agency level bid protests, GAO bid protests, requests for debriefings, employee-employer actions, contests of OMBC A-76 competition performance decisions). (c) If resolution cannot be made by the contracting officer, concerned parties may contact the Center/MAJCOM ombudsmen, Mrs. Diane Dade, 1535 Command Drive, Suite 202, Andrews AFB, Camp Spring MD, 20762 Phone # 301-981-7342. Concerns, issues, disagreements, and recommendations that cannot be resolved at the MAJCOM/DRU level, may be brought by the concerned party for further consideration to the Air Force ombudsman, Associate Deputy Assistant Secretary (ADAS) (Contracting), SAF/AQC, 1060 Air Force Pentagon, Washington DC 20330-1060, phone number (703) 588-7004, facsimile number (703) 588-1067. (d) The ombudsman has no authority to render a decision that binds the agency. (e) Do not contact the ombudsman to request copies of the solicitation, verify offer due date, or clarify technical requirements. Such inquiries shall be directed to the Contracting Officer.
